Abstract

Aim: This in-viro study aimed to evaluate and compare the shear bond strength of resin cement with high translucency zirconia with silane coupling agents and bonding agent separately (Group3), bonding agent containing silane (Group 2) and bonding agent which does not have silane (Group 1). Materials and Methods: The study was conducted by using the high translucency zirconia blanks along with the CAD-CAM equipments. After sintering the specimens according to manufacturer’s instructions surface modifications, bonding procedures and evaluation of bond strength was performed. Bond strength of the samples was tested using universal testing machine. The results were analyzed statistically using descriptive analysis. Results: The mean shear bond strength obtained for group 1, group 2 and group 3 was 17.97, 22.01, 28.87MPA respectively. The SBS of group 3 was significantly higher than the other two groups as the surface of zirconia was treated with both Silane and Silane-containing universal adhesive. Conclusion: The null hypothesis was rejected. Within the limitations of the study, it was concluded that the shear bond strength between resin cement and high translucency zirconia was highest when treated with bonding agent (universal adhesive) and silane coupling agent separately after air particle abrasion.
